## GraphQL N+1 Fix (Larkspur API)

Last sprint we resolved the N+1 pattern in the `orders -> lineItems` resolver by introducing a batched loader keyed on order ID. Query counts per request fell from ~300 to 4. The loader talks to the Pinewheel cache tier, which requires authentication in staging and production. To test locally against staging, add the cache credential on the next line of your env file.

sealed setting: VAULT_KEY20=69e2a0b23f1a79fbf692

**Mgmt Meeting Minutes — Retiring the Brightline Range**

Quick recap for sales leads at Fenholt Supplies: we agreed to retire the Brightline fixture range by year-end. Remaining stock moves to clearance pricing next month, and accounts on standing orders get migrated to the Lumetta range. Trade-in incentives were approved in principle. The confidential note on next steps sits just below.

board note of bajof-bajeg: The pricing group signed off on a budget of $13.4 million for Project Sildor. The renewal with Lamixek Holdings closes at $48.9 million a year, 49 percent above the last contract.

## Deploying the Gatewick Proctor Queue

Deploys are pretty painless: push to main, wait for the pipeline, then watch the queue drain dashboard for five minutes. If candidates pile up mid-exam, roll back first and ask questions later — the queue replays safely. Everything the workers care about lives in one config block, shown here for reference.

settings of bafof-yagef:
JOROX_PIN=8740
JOROX_TENANT=pelox
JOROX_METRICS_HOST=metrics.jorox.qorvelworks.internal
JOROX_SEAL=seal_c78f63c1
JOROX_STANDBY_TEAM=norax

Step 2: Enable the validator plugin system. In Glimmerbrook 3.x, data validators are no longer compiled into the core binary; they load as plugins from a registry directory at startup. Copy your existing custom validators into that directory and confirm each one appears in the startup log — a silent skip usually means a version mismatch in the plugin manifest. Take your time here; a missing validator fails open. The loader expects the following configuration.

config for bahop-fajep:
DRUATH_PIN=4501
DRUATH_TENANT=briwyn
DRUATH_METRICS_HOST=metrics.druath.brasksoft.test
DRUATH_SEAL=seal_7d2e069d
DRUATH_STANDBY_TEAM=olieth